秋霞福利一区 Invites Community to Free Spring Spectacular Concert, Fireworks and Inauguration Celebration May 1
MOBILE, Ala. 鈥 The 秋霞福利一区 invites the community to campus May 1 for its annual Spring Spectacular outdoor concert and fireworks show. This is a free event, and guests are encouraged to bring lawn chairs and blankets to enjoy the show on the Great Commission Lawn.
A pre-show featuring the Saraland Elementary Show Choir will begin at 7 p.m.
Spring Spectacular, featuring students from 秋霞福利一区鈥檚 Alabama School of the Arts, will start at 7:30 p.m. The evening will conclude with an impressive fireworks show lighting the sky above the university鈥檚 iconic Weaver Hall.
Spring Spectacular is the Baptist university鈥檚 end-of-year concert showcasing a wide variety of ensembles in the Alabama School of the Arts, from Voices of Mobile to RamCorps. The university is located off I-65 at Exit 13, 5735 College Pkwy., Mobile, Alabama, 36613.

Inauguration Day Festivities
Spring Spectacular is the concluding event of the university鈥檚 day-long celebration of the inauguration of its 6th president, Dr. Charles W. Smith Jr.
The inaugural celebration will begin at 2:30 p.m. at Redemption Church in Saraland, Alabama, with special guests from across the Southern Baptist Convention, delegates from colleges and universities across the nation, local and state leaders, and the university community. Dr. Jason Allen, president of Midwestern Baptist Theological Seminary, will deliver the keynote address, followed by a presidential response from Dr. Smith.
Both Spring Spectacular and the Inaugural Celebration are open to the public.
For Christ & His Kingdom
Dr. Smith was unanimously elected as the sixth president of the 秋霞福利一区 on March 21, 2024. Under his leadership, the renewed vision of the 秋霞福利一区 is to focus on advancing the mission 鈥淔or Christ & His Kingdom鈥 by multiplying Kingdom leaders who embrace their callings and live out the Great Commission for the glory of God and the good of the world.
A native of Montgomery, Alabama, Dr. Smith holds a PhD from Southeastern Baptist Theological Seminary and Master of Divinity from The Southern Baptist Theological Seminary. Over the years, he has served in a variety of leadership roles in theological education, most recently as senior vice president for institutional relations at Midwestern Baptist Theological Seminary and Spurgeon College.
He is married to Ashley, his high school sweetheart, and together they have three daughters: Ellie, Annie and Susie.

About the 秋霞福利一区
The 秋霞福利一区 is a Christ-centered university pursuing excellence 鈥淔or Christ & His Kingdom.鈥 With a vision to 鈥淢ultiply Kingdom Leaders for the Glory of God and the Good of the World,鈥 the university honors God by equipping students for their future professions in an environment where they are known.
The university was founded in 1961 and is affiliated with the Alabama Baptist State Convention.
